Software Engineer - Data

Cambridge, MA /
Data Engineering – Data Engineering /
Full-time
At Kensho, we hire talented people and give them the freedom, support, and resources needed to build cutting edge technology and products for our parent company, S&P Global. As a result, we produce technology that is scalable, robust, and solves the challenges of one of the world’s largest, most successful financial institutions. 

We are seeking mid-level experienced Data Engineers to join our Data Engineering Team. The team is responsible for architecting, implementing, and maintaining Kensho’s data ingestion, processing, and storage solutions. They work with stakeholders across Kensho and S&P to map the data landscape, triage data requirements, and design and implement a comprehensive data strategy. 

Our ideal candidate has experience with the tasks and skills below:

    • Designing, coordinating, and implementing production data platforms using industry standard and/or open source software
    • Navigating between technical leadership and individual contributor roles
    • Negotiating between new requirements, legacy systems, technical debt, and best practices
    • Mentoring colleagues on data engineering best practices and systems design

What You'll Do:

    • Work with industry standard and/or open source software such as PostgreSQL, Kafka, Airflow, etc
    • Implement and maintain a data management and governance framework
    • Support machine learning and application teams by setting up custom data solutions
    • Design, maintain, and scale Kensho’s data pipeline and document processing platform
    • Build event and batch driven ingestion systems for stand-alone software products, machine learning R&D, and API services
    • Develop and administer databases, knowledge bases, and distributed data stores
    • Create and use systems to clean, integrate, or fuse datasets to produce data products
    • Perform continuous and periodic studies on systems cost efficiency, performance, and overall health
    • Establish and monitor data integrity and value through visualization, profiling, and statistical tools
    • Implement and maintain a data management and governance framework

What You'll Need:

    • Experience with various data-store technologies, distributed messaging platforms, or data processing framework
    • Experience designing, architecting and building reliable data pipelines
    • Experience working with large structured and unstructured data sets
    • Effective coding, documentation, and communication habits
    • Proficient understanding of distributed computing principles
    • Experience integrating/fusing data from multiple data sources
    • Knowledge of various ETL techniques, frameworks, and best practices
    • Experience supporting and working with cross-functional teams in a dynamic environment
    • (Bonus) Experience with Site Reliability Engineering, DevOps (CICD), and Cloud Administration
At Kensho, we pride ourselves on providing top-of-market benefits, including:
 
-       Medical, Dental, and Vision insurance 
-       100% company paid premiums
-       Unlimited Paid Time Off
-       20 weeks of 100% paid Parental Leave (paternity and maternity)
-       401(k) plan with 6% employer matching
-       Generous company matching on donations to non-profit charities
-       Up to $20,000 tuition assistance toward degree programs, plus up to $4,000/year for ongoing professional education such as industry conferences
-       Plentiful snacks, drinks, and regularly catered lunches
-       Dog-friendly office (CAM office)
-       In-office gyms and showers (CAM, DC) or Equinox membership (LA, NYC)
-       Stipend towards commuter or gym reimbursement
-       Bike sharing program memberships
-       Compassion leave and elder care leave
-       Mentoring and additional learning opportunities
-       Opportunity to expand professional network and participate in conferences and events 
 
About Kensho
Kensho uses machine learning, artificial intelligence, natural language processing and data visualization techniques to solve some of the hardest analytical problems and create breakthrough financial intelligence solutions for our parent company, S&P Global. 
 
Kensho was founded in 2013 by Harvard & MIT alums and was acquired by S&P Global in 2018. Kensho continues to operate as a startup in order to maintain our distinct, independent brand and to promote our breakthrough, innovative culture. Our team of Kenshins enjoy a dynamic and collaborative work environment that runs autonomously from S&P, while leveraging the unparalleled breadth and depth of data and resources available as part of S&P Global.  As Kenshins, we pride ourselves on maintaining an innovative culture that depends on diversity and inclusion.
 
We are an equal opportunity employer that welcomes future Kenshins with all experiences and perspectives. Kensho is headquartered in Cambridge, MA, with offices in New York City, Washington D.C. and Los Angeles.  All qualified applicants will receive consideration for employment without regard to race, color, religion, sex, sexual orientation, gender identity, or national origin.